Hang Seng Rally Loses Steam: Can Tencent Earnings Be the Next Catalyst?

After a rapid rebound, the Hong Kong Hang Seng Index has seen its upward momentum weaken significantly in recent sessions. Market participants point to technical overbought conditions, cautious capital flows, and external uncertainties as factors suppressing further upside. Against this backdrop, the upcoming quarterly earnings report from Tencent Holdings (00700.HK) is viewed as a key variable that could break the impasse.

Technical Picture: Rally Stalls on Low Volume

From a technical standpoint, the Hang Seng has hit a key resistance zone during its rebound. Multiple technical analysis firms note that trading volume has not expanded in tandem as the index approaches the previous dense trading area, indicating limited willingness to chase prices higher. The Relative Strength Index (RSI) briefly entered overbought territory before retreating, suggesting increased short-term profit-taking pressure. Additionally, the lower boundary of the rising channel formed during the rebound is being tested; a breakdown could trigger technical selling.

Capital Flows: Foreign Caution, Divergent Southbound Flows

On the capital flow front, foreign investors have recently adopted a more conservative stance toward Hong Kong stocks. According to HKEX data, northbound capital saw net outflows in the later stages of the rebound, while southbound capital maintained net buying but at a reduced pace compared to earlier. Market analysts attribute this to persistent uncertainty over Fed rate cuts, geopolitical risks, and global growth concerns, which keep international investors on the sidelines. The recent weakness in the Hong Kong dollar also reflects subdued appetite for inflows into the Hong Kong market.

Tencent Earnings: A Key Litmus Test for Market Sentiment

As the heaviest weighted constituent in the Hang Seng Index, Tencent's earnings performance has a significant impact on the index's trajectory. Market expectations are focused on the upcoming report, particularly on advertising business recovery, game license approvals, and cloud business profitability. According to industry research, Tencent's cost-cutting and efficiency efforts may be showing early results, but whether revenue growth can return to double digits remains a key focus for the market.

If Tencent's results beat expectations, it could lift sentiment across the tech sector and help the Hang Seng break through its current resistance zone. Conversely, a miss could heighten concerns about Hong Kong's earnings outlook, leading to further index pullback. Notably, Tencent's recent moves in the AI large model space are also drawing attention, with related progress likely to be a hot topic on the earnings call.

External Environment: Fed Policy and Geopolitical Risks Intertwine

Beyond domestic factors, the external environment also influences Hong Kong stocks. The latest Fed meeting minutes reveal lingering divisions among policymakers on the inflation outlook, with uncertainty over the timing of rate cuts fueling volatility in global asset prices. Additionally, geopolitical factors such as US-China relations and Middle East tensions continue to disrupt risk appetite. Analysts note that Hong Kong stocks are unlikely to stage an independent rally until external risks ease significantly.

Outlook: Waiting for a Catalyst, Eyeing Structural Opportunities

In summary, the Hang Seng's short-term rebound momentum is fading, and the market is entering a phase of direction selection. Whether Tencent's earnings can serve as a new catalyst will depend on the quality of its earnings and forward guidance. If the report highlights are strong, it could attract renewed capital inflows into Hong Kong stocks; if lackluster, the index may need more time to digest pressure. Investors can focus on structural opportunities in high-dividend, low-valuation sectors while closely monitoring policy and capital flow changes.
